On-Site Heat Treating Facility-ISPM-15 Compliant Stamped and Certified Pallets – For your products shipped outside the U.S., the pallets you use will be required to comply with the International Phytosanitary Measure known as ISPM 15. Compliance involves “Heat Treating” pallets to reduce the risk of introduction and/or spread of quarantined pests. Be sure to purchase heat treated pallets uniformly marked with the same IPPC stamp. Recycled pallets bearing different IPPC markings have not been heat treated as is required with each subsequent repair. All IPPC markings on heat treated recycled pallets must be obliterated except for your supplier’s own marking. Insist on a written certification bearing your supplier’s stamp with each purchase of heat treated pallets.
